The Spirit took to home ice for one game against the Meramec #1 Sharks this past weekend. Springfield had already beaten the Sharks in the Firebird tournament just a little over a month ago. The Spirit would use home ice advantage and skate to a 4-1 victory.

Midway through the first Gavin Loven found an open Zahn Werner in the high slot. Werner fired a shot that the Shark goalie could not control as it bounced off his glove and into the net for a 1-0 lead. The Sharks would strike back less than 2 minutes later to tie the game at 1. Late in the 2nd Loven found a Brooks Kettering rebound and put the puck in the top corner from a sharp angle to make it 2-1 Spirit. Midway through the third it was Kettering finding a rebound off a Will Peters shot making it 3-1 Spirit. Other assist on the goal went to Cal Bussen.  The defense tightened up and did not let a goal slip by the rest of the way. Cooper Pumphrey picks up the win stopping 14/15 shots. Player of the game belt went to John Brown who continues to sacrifice his body to block shots and get in the way of opposing players.

The Spirit are 1st in their division with a record of 6-1 in league play and are 16-2-2 overall.

Springfield will hit the road for 3 tough games in St. Louis as they will take on Kirkwood #2 twice and the St. Peters Spirit. Kirkwood #2 is in second place right behind the Spirit and will be looking to climb to the top. St. Peters is #1 in their respective division and should pose a tough test for the Spirit.
